Overview
Johann Mendel (Gregor was the name given to him only later by his Augustinian order, Fig. ) was born on July 20, 1822 to an ethnic German family, Anton and Rosina Mendel (Fig. ), in Heinzendorf in the Austrian Empire at the Moravian‐Silesian border (now Hynčice, Czech Republic).
